Today, the UP2DATE consortium has organised a half-day workshop with the Industrial Advisory Board  (IAB) to bring them up to date on latest project progress.

This is the 3rd meeting that the project organises with its IAB, which is comprised by members of very diverse domains (Automotive, Space, Avionics, Certification):

  • Jorge Robles (Orbital critical systems)
  • Stephan Marwedel (AIRBUS)
  • Christos Sofronis (Collins Aerospace)
  • Achim Rettberg (FAT)
  • Gebhard Bouwer (TÜV Rheinland)
  • Umut Durak (DLR)

The consortium has presented the main advances of the first half of the project, divided in three main blocks:

  1. Architecture definition and safety-security concept (Irune Agirre)
  2. Update framework (Patrick Uven)
  3. Monitoring (Leonidas Kosmidis)

Thanks to the interdisciplinarity of the IAB, the meeting has lead to many interesting discussions and comments that made us think about how future critical system architectures will look like. As a result of the workshop, the IAB has provided a set of recommendations based on the expertise of its members to the project.

The interesting meeting outcomes will definitely shape our future work!
